September 18, 1924 ~ April 3, 2007

Lorene Spencer September 18, 1924 - April 03, 2007 Lorene Spencer, 82, of Yellowwood Drive died at 4:55 a.m. Tuesday, April 3, 2007, at Columbus Regional Hospital. Mrs. Spencer retired from Bartholomew County Sheriffs Department where she was a cook. She enjoyed cooking and visiting with her friends, was an avid camper and a member of Hoosier Schooners. Born in Hartsville Sept. 18, 1924, Mrs. Spencer was the daughter of Nolan and Blanche Sneed. She married R. Earl Spencer May 4, 1944. Survivors include a son, Dallas L. (Joyce) Spencer of Columbus; a daughter, Joan M. Bragg of Brownstown; grandchildren, Jeff and Lori Spencer, Rhea Sweeney, Sonya Gray and Stacey McCarty; a brother, Jean Sneed of Hartsville; sisters, Dottie Ridner of Hartsville and Ruth Ann Tindle of Florida; and eight great-grandchildren. She was preceded in death by her husband in 1989; her parents; and a brother, Jack Sneed. Funeral Information FUNERAL: 1 p.m. Friday, April 6, 2007 at Jewell-Rittman Family Funeral Home. VISITATION: 4 to 8 p.m. Thursday and from noon until service time Friday. BURIAL: Garland Brook Cemetery. DirectionsVisitation:  Map to Funeral Home
